Childhood is a precious time of innocence and exploration, shaping the foundation of who we become as individuals. However, for some, it can also be a period marred by experiences that leave lasting emotional imprints. This is childhood trauma.

Childhood trauma refers to distressing events or adverse experiences endured during early years, often between the ages of 0 to 7, when the mind is highly impressionable.

Trauma can take many forms, ranging from emotional, physical, or sexual abuse, neglect, witnessing violence, or even sudden losses.

These distressing events can profoundly impact a child’s sense of safety, trust, and overall well-being, creating deep-rooted beliefs that may continue to affect them well into adulthood.
